“Abraham’s bosom” is found in the Parable of the Rich Man and Lazarus Jesus taught about Heaven and Hell. Lazarus went into Hades (limbo), a place of rest, contentment, and peace, whereas the rich man found himself into Hell unaided and in torment. Hades was contiguous with Hell.
After Jesus’ death on a cross, He was placed in a tomb to remain forever. Yet, when Jesus was in the tomb, He descended into Hell in spirit to gain control over Satan and release all souls from Hades into Heaven.
There is no biblical evidence Adam and Eve were saved. It seems they affirmed the basic truths of the gospel and confessed their need for the Savior promised to them. Adam and Eve were released from Hades (limbo) into Heaven.
God had never intended death for people, but Adam and Eve introduced death into the world.
People who believe in the redemptive power of Christ on the Cross believe the grave is a passage to Heaven. Jesus claimed the keys of Hades (limbo) from Satan who would not have control over a person destiny upon death.
Each person will live eternity in Heaven or Hell. The rich man focused on life on Earth; Lazarus trusted in God and endured many hardships. Lazarus died and was carried by angels to Abraham’s bosom. The rich man also died, and being in torments in Hell, he lifted his eyes and saw Abraham afar and Lazarus in his bosom.”
Physical death separates body from soul, whereas spiritual death separates soul from God. Jesus taught we ought not fear physical death but be concerned about spiritual death. Seeking or disregarding God on Earth determine our eternal destiny: Heaven or Hell.
